How to Clean a Leather Rug: The Ultimate Guide

When you think of leather, you probably imagine supple, sleek leather jackets or the plush rug in your friend’s apartment. It doesn’t immediately conjure images of a pile of dirt-colored fibers that appear to be rotting away. However, even the most pristine leather rugs will get dirty over time. However, there is no need to panic if you see your leather rug in a less than desirable state. With the right care and maintenance routine, your leather rug can look brand new again. Cleaning a leather rug requires some different techniques than cleaning other types of rugs; however, this guide will help you understand how to clean a leather rug so that it lasts for years to come!

Why is my Leather Rug Dirty?

Every rug will get dirty over time, but you might be surprised to see how quickly leather rugs can get grimy. This is because leather is a porous material that is much more likely to trap dirt and dust than other types of rugs.

Before you start cleaning, it is important to identify why your leather rug is so grimy. Depending on the condition of the rug, different cleaning methods may be required. This will help you avoid damaging your rug and make sure that your cleaning method is effective.


Perhaps the most common reason leather rugs get dirty is because of stains. If a cleaning agent spills on your rug, it is much more likely to stain than synthetic fibers. This is because the surface of leather is not as smooth as synthetic fibers, so the cleaning agent sits on top of the rug and doesn’t easily evaporate.

Dust and fibers

Another common reason for dirty leather rugs is dust and fibers. If your rug is exposed to high levels of foot traffic, it is likely to collect a great deal of dust and fibers over time. While synthetic fibers can easily be cleaned away, dust and fibers that land on a leather rug can be much more difficult to remove.

How to Clean a New Leather Rug?

New rugs are likely to be extremely dirty; however, it is important not to use a harsh cleaning method that could potentially damage the fibers. While you will need to clean your rug more frequently, a gentler cleaning method will help prevent damage to the fibers.

Damp cleaning

One of the gentlest cleaning methods is to use a damp cloth. This can be particularly useful for removing smaller stains that are easy to wipe away. Be careful not to make the rag too wet, as this could damage the fibers of your rug.

Mild detergent

If your rug has stubborn stains, mild detergent can be a helpful tool. Make sure to dilute the detergent and clean the stain as soon as it appears to avoid making it worse. The sooner you clean your rug, the easier it will be to remove the stain.

Air freshener

Over time, a rug can develop an unpleasant smell. This is particularly common for rugs that are frequently used, like in a kitchen or hallway. Spraying your rug with an air freshener will help remove any lingering odors.

How to Deep Clean a Stained Leather Rug?

Generally, you should use a gentler cleaning method when cleaning a new rug. However, if a stain has developed over time, you may need to use harsher cleaning agents to remove it.

Professional cleaning

Professional cleaning services can help you remove difficult stains from your rug. These services can use stronger cleaning agents to break down the stain and remove it from your rug.

Oily stains

If your rug has an oily stain, use a mild detergent solution and a sponge to scrub it clean. Make sure to rinse the sponge completely to avoid spreading the oil around your rug.

Sticky stains

Sticky substances like sap, glue, and gum can be difficult to remove. You can try to dissolve the substance with a warm, soapy water solution, but it may be best to go to a professional if the substance is stuck in the fibers of your rug.

How to Clean an Oiled Leather Rug?

Oil is a common problem for leather rugs. It can stain the surface of the rug and also make it more difficult to clean in the future. The best way to remove oil from a leather rug is to use a cleaning agent designed for this purpose.

Solvent cleaner

Use solvent cleaners to break down the oil and remove it from your rug. Make sure to follow the label instructions for the best results.

Cleaning agent

Cleaning agents are another good option for removing oil from a leather rug. Choose a product that is designed specifically for cleaning leather; these products will likely be slightly stronger than cleaning agents designed for synthetic fibers.

How to Dry and Sanitize a Wet Leather Rug?

If you are cleaning a wet rug, you will want to use a gentler cleaning method than you would for a dry rug. You don’t want to risk damaging the fibers, especially if your rug is already stained.

Damp cleaning

Any cleaning agent that is safe for use on dry rugs is also safe for use on wet rugs. However, a damp cloth can be particularly effective if your rug is wet.

Mild detergent

As discussed above, a mild detergent can be a helpful tool for cleaning a new or stained rug. However, you should use it sparingly if your rug is wet, as it can make the fibers more prone to damage.

Air freshener

Spraying your rug with an air freshener will remove any lingering odors and make it smell fresh again.

Tips for Maintaining Your Leather Rug

Your leather rug will be much more durable if you keep it clean and properly maintained. This will prevent dirt and grime from building up and damaging the fibers.

Regular cleaning

It is important to clean your leather rug regularly. This will help prevent stains and remove dust and dirt that can damage the fibers. It is also important to clean your rug regularly so that you don’t end up damaging the fibers with harsh cleaning agents.

Protect your rug

You can protect your rug by covering it when you don’t want to use it. This will keep it free from the elements, which can damage leather when it is exposed to too much water or sunlight.

Choose the right rug

Selecting the right rug for your space can help you prevent stains and breakdown of the fibers. Choose a rug that is large enough to cover a high-traffic area without being so big that it looks out of place.


How do you take care of a leather rug?

To take care of a leather rug, you should vacuum it regularly to remove any dirt or dust. You can also use a damp cloth to wipe it down if needed. If the rug gets wet, be sure to dry it off completely before using a vacuum or brush to clean it.

Can you dry clean leather rugs?

Leather rugs can be dry cleaned, but it is not recommended. The harsh chemicals used in the dry cleaning process can damage the leather. Instead, a gentle vacuum or dusting is usually all that is needed to keep a leather rug clean.

Can you wash a leather rug in the washing machine?

Leather rugs should not be washed in the washing machine, as this can damage the rug. Instead, they should be cleaned using a vacuum cleaner or a damp cloth.

How do you clean a faux leather rug?

To clean a faux leather rug, start by shaking it off to remove any loose dirt or dust. Then, use a vacuum cleaner with the upholstery attachment to clean the surface of the rug. If there is any dirt or stains on the rug, you can use a mild detergent and a damp cloth to clean it. Be sure to rinse the cloth thoroughly after each stroke, and avoid getting the fabric wet. Let the rug air dry before using it again.

How do you clean woven leather?

To clean woven leather, you can use a damp cloth and some soap. Be sure to dry the leather completely afterwards, or it could become damaged.

Bottom line

Although leather is a durable material, it can be damaged by improper cleaning. The best way to clean a leather rug is to use a mild cleaning agent and clean it regularly. Protecting your rug from the elements and using the right rug for your space will help it last for years to come. If your rug does get dirty, don’t panic! You can clean it with a mild solution, or bring it to a professional cleaner. Make sure to follow these cleaning tips to keep your rug looking brand new!